CO-OPERATION OF KESLA AND VALTRA SHOWS ON THE FINNMETKO 2016 EXHIBITION KESLA tractor forest equipment range has been almost fully renewed during past few years. Now, for display on the FinnMETKO, there is a wide range of thought-over trailers and loaders with Valtra-tractors. On the stand, there are also examples of Valtra Unlimited installations, in which the compatibility of the KESLA forestry equipment, the tractor and the installation has been taken to totally new level. Valtra representant AGCO Suomi (Finland) Oy started as retailer of KESLA tractor forest equipment in the beginning of this year and they are strongly present on the Kesla stand also.

„Just the right sort of crane for us"

09.08.2016 Referenssit

The German timber transportation company „Schwinn Nah- und Fernverkehr GmbH“ chose the strong tree-length crane KESLA 2028 and a KESLA proCAB cabin due to the wish of one of the drivers in the company, Jürgen Hector. Also the concept of the whole vehicle is pleasing: a semi-trailer with extendable frame for timber lengths from 2.5 m up to 19 m is an all-rounder for all.

KWF Press release: The new generation of KESLA stroke harvesters

09.06.2016 Uutiset

Kesla is a Finnish multitalent in forest technology, known for its wide range of high quality roller and stroke harvester heads. The KESLA SH-series stroke harvester heads have now been renewed to a totally new level. Focus in the renewal has been in performance, reliability, durability and economy. Result is to be seen on the KWF-exhibition Germany in June 2016.
